Output 629995880d71c7a73c7a870f80393f3553bc22b963ea473bbd1e58996c627a62:0

value
9979288760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ff3186ffc2441e519c012a3876d80a0922a1bd0 OP_EQUALVERIFY OP_CHECKSIG
address
12TLMSsVAjeuBn9SCX1vcdSJ6a3W7abJ2C
transaction
629995880d71c7a73c7a870f80393f3553bc22b963ea473bbd1e58996c627a62
spent
true